Description
The property offers two well-appointed bathrooms, each fitted with heated floors to ensure your comfort on chilly mornings. The first bathroom is a highlight of the home, complete with a luxurious free-standing bath where you can easily unwind at the end of a long day.
The heart of the home is undoubtedly the open-plan kitchen. This space is flooded with natural light,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. The kitchen also offers a convenient dining space, perfect for family meals or entertaining guests. A stunning kitchen island stands as a centrepiece, providing additional worktop and storage space.
The residence also benefits from two reception rooms, offering ample space for relaxation or socialising. The thoughtful layout of these rooms allows for a seamless flow throughout the home.
The location of the property is particularly appealing. It's close to local amenities, schools, and parks, offering countless opportunities for outdoor activities such as walking and cycling. These surroundings make this house perfect for families who appreciate a balance of convenience and leisure activities. EPC Grade - awaiting.

Ground Floor
Entrance Porch
Door leading to the hallway.
Hallway
Stairs leading to the first floor. Radiator, coving and ceiling light point.
Downstairs WC
Two piece suite comprising of low level WC and pedestal wash hand basin. Part tiled walls and tiled flooring with under floor heating. Ceiling light point.
Lounge
Double glazed bay window to the front aspect. Feature multi fuel stove. Ceiling light point, ceiling rose and picture rail. Stunning features providing character through-out the home.
Dining Room
Double glazed window to the rear aspect. Radiator, ceiling light point, coving and picture rail.
Kitchen Diner
Good range of wall and base units with contrasting work surfaces incorporating one bowl insert sink. Space for a Range cooker and American Fridge Freezer. Part tiled walls. Under floor heating. Space for a dining table. Spotlights an ceiling light point. Patio doors leading out to the balcony area. Door leading to steps down to the garden.
First Floor
Landing
Split level landing with fitted cupboard providing additional storage space. Feature skylight. Spotlights. Radiator. Access to the loft space with a pull down ladder.
Bedroom One
Two double glazed window to the front aspect. Built in fitted cupboard providing storage space. Feature cast iron fireplace. Picture rail. Radiator and ceiling light point. Door leading to the en-suite.
Ensuite
Three piece suite comprising of a walk in shower, vanity wash hand basin and low level WC. Part tiled walls and tiled floor with under floor heating. Radiator and Spotlights. Double glazed window to the front aspect. Please note this was previously bedroom four.
Bedroom Two
Double glazed window to the rear aspect. Radiator and ceiling light point. Built in cupboards.
Bedroom Three
Double glazed window to the rear aspect. Radiator and ceiling light point.
Family Bathroom
Three piece suite comprising of a free standing bath, pedestal wash hand basin and low level WC. Part tiled walls and tiled flooring with under floor heating. Ceiling light point. Double glazed window.
External
Front
To the front there is a driveway providing off road parking.
Rear
Large garden with stunning views. There is a raised balcony off the Kitchen Diner which tiled. There is a lawn area with mature shrubs. Space for a shed and vegetable plot. The garden provides lots of potential and is perfect for entertaining guests.
Garage
The garage benefits from a car pit perfect for any car enthusiasts. There are wall and base units and plumbing for a washing machine. The garage also benefits from power and lighting.
